Skip to content

Commit

Permalink
Tidy up #includes
Browse files Browse the repository at this point in the history
- move to CaptialWords format for Qt includes
- use forward declarations where possible
- removed many unnecessary #includes in *.h files


git-svn-id: http://svn.osgeo.org/qgis/trunk/qgis@4992 c8812cc2-4d05-0410-92ff-de0c093fc19c
  • Loading branch information
g_j_m committed Mar 10, 2006
1 parent fefbfcd commit 491ea95
Show file tree
Hide file tree
Showing 29 changed files with 81 additions and 126 deletions.
24 changes: 2 additions & 22 deletions src/gui/qgisapp.cpp
Expand Up @@ -25,27 +25,20 @@
#include <QAction>
#include <QApplication>
#include <QBitmap>
#include <QByteArray>
#include <QCheckBox>
#include <QClipboard>
#include <QColor>
#include <QCursor>
#include <QDesktopWidget>
#include <QDialog>
#include <QDir>
#include <QErrorMessage>
#include <QEvent>
#include <QFile>
#include <QFileInfo>
#include <QGridLayout>
#include <QImage>
#include <QInputDialog>
#include <QKeyEvent>
#include <QLabel>
#include <QLayout>
#include <QLibrary>
#include <QListView>
#include <QMatrix>
#include <QMenu>
#include <QMenuBar>
#include <QMenuItem>
Expand All @@ -57,24 +50,15 @@
#include <QPrinter>
#include <QProcess>
#include <QProgressBar>
#include <QPushButton>
#include <QRect>
#include <QRegExp>
#include <QScrollArea>
#include <QSettings>
#include <QSplitter>
#include <QStatusBar>
#include <QStatusBar>
#include <QStringList>
#include <QTcpSocket>
#include <QTextStream>
#include <QTimer>
#include <QToolBar>
#include <QToolBox>
#include <QToolButton>
#include <QToolTip>
#include <QVBoxLayout>
#include <QWhatsThis>
#include <QSplashScreen>
//
// QGIS Specific Includes
//
Expand Down Expand Up @@ -119,6 +103,7 @@
#include "qgsvectorfilewriter.h"
#include "qgsvectorlayer.h"
#include "qgisplugin.h"
#include "qgsvectordataprovider.h"
#include "../../images/themes/default/qgis.xpm"

//
Expand Down Expand Up @@ -150,11 +135,6 @@
#include "qgsmaptoolzoom.h"
#include "qgsmeasure.h"


//#include "qgssisydialog.h"
// XXX deprecated?? #include "qgslegenditem.h"


//
// Conditional Includes
//
Expand Down
38 changes: 13 additions & 25 deletions src/gui/qgisapp.h
Expand Up @@ -19,44 +19,35 @@
#ifndef QGISAPP_H
#define QGISAPP_H

//Added by qt3to4:
#include <QMenu>
#include <QKeyEvent>
#include <QEvent>
#include <QPixmap>
#include <QLabel>
#include <QSplashScreen>
class QCanvas;
class QRect;
class QCanvasView;
class QStringList;
class QScrollView;
class QgsPoint;
class QgsLegend;
class QgsLegendView;
class QVBox;
class QCursor;
class QLabel;
class QListView;
class Q3ListViewItem;
class QProgressBar;
class QFileInfo;
class QgsMapLayer;
class QSettings;
class QTcpSocket;
class QCheckBox;
class QToolButton;
class QKeyEvent;
class QMenu;
class QPixmap;
class QSplashScreen;

class QgsPoint;
class QgsLegend;
class QgsMapLayer;
class QgsProviderRegistry;
class QgsHelpViewer;
class QgsMapCanvas;
class QgsMapLayerRegistry;
class QgsRasterLayer;
class QCheckBox;
class QEvent;
class QgsComposer;
class QPushButton;
class QToolButton;

#include "qgisiface.h"
#include "qgsconfig.h"
#include "qgsvectordataprovider.h"
//#include "qgsconfig.h"

#include "qgsclipboard.h"

#include <map>
Expand Down Expand Up @@ -522,9 +513,6 @@ public slots:
QMenu *toolPopupDisplay;
//! Popup menu for the capture tools
QMenu *toolPopupCapture;
//! Legend list view control
//doesnt see to be used...(TS)
//QgsLegendView *mLegendView;
//! Map canvas
QgsMapCanvas *mMapCanvas;
//! Map layer registry
Expand Down
1 change: 0 additions & 1 deletion src/gui/qgisinterface.cpp
Expand Up @@ -17,7 +17,6 @@
****************************************************************************/
/* $Id$ */

#include <iostream>
#include "qgisinterface.h"
#include "qgisapp.h"

Expand Down
8 changes: 3 additions & 5 deletions src/gui/qgisinterface.h
Expand Up @@ -19,15 +19,13 @@
#ifndef QGISINTERFACE_H
#define QGISINTERFACE_H

#include <qaction.h>
#include <QAction>
#include <QWidget>

#include <qwidget.h>
//Added by qt3to4:
#include <Q3PopupMenu>
#include <map>

class QgisApp;
class QgsMapLayer;
class Q3PopupMenu;
class QgsMapCanvas;
class QgsRasterLayer;
class QgsMapLayerRegistry;
Expand Down
4 changes: 2 additions & 2 deletions src/gui/qgsattributeaction.cpp
Expand Up @@ -26,8 +26,8 @@
#include <iostream>
#include <vector>

#include <qstringlist.h>
#include <qdom.h>
#include <QStringList>
#include <QDomElement>

#include "qgsattributeaction.h"
#include "qgsrunprocess.h"
Expand Down
4 changes: 2 additions & 2 deletions src/gui/qgsattributeaction.h
Expand Up @@ -25,8 +25,8 @@
#ifndef QGSATTRIBUTEACTION_H
#define QGSATTRIBUTEACTION_H

#include <qstring.h>
#include <qobject.h>
#include <QString>
#include <QObject>

#include <list>
#include <vector>
Expand Down
21 changes: 10 additions & 11 deletions src/gui/qgsattributetable.cpp
Expand Up @@ -16,22 +16,21 @@
* *
***************************************************************************/
/* $Id$ */
#include <qapplication.h>
#include <qcursor.h>
#include <q3popupmenu.h>
#include <qlabel.h>
#include <qfont.h>
#include <qglobal.h>
#include <qclipboard.h>
#include <QApplication>
#include <QMouseEvent>
#include <Q3PopupMenu>
#include <QKeyEvent>
#include <QLabel>
#include <QFont>
#include <QClipboard>
#include <Q3ValueList>

#include "qgsattributetable.h"
#include "qgsfeature.h"
#include "qgsfield.h"
#include "qgsvectordataprovider.h"
#include "qgsvectorlayer.h"
//Added by qt3to4:
#include <QKeyEvent>
#include <Q3ValueList>
#include <QMouseEvent>

#include <iostream>
#include <stdlib.h>

Expand Down
11 changes: 5 additions & 6 deletions src/gui/qgsattributetable.h
Expand Up @@ -19,18 +19,17 @@
#ifndef QGSATTRIBUTETABLE_H
#define QGSATTRIBUTETABLE_H

#include <q3table.h>
#include <qmap.h>
//Added by qt3to4:
#include <QMouseEvent>
#include <QKeyEvent>
#include <Q3PopupMenu>
#include <Q3Table>
#include <QMap>

#include <map>
#include <set>

class Q3PopupMenu;
class QgsVectorLayer;
class QgsFeature;
class QMouseEvent;
class QKeyEvent;

#include "qgsattributeaction.h"

Expand Down
8 changes: 4 additions & 4 deletions src/gui/qgsclipboard.cpp
Expand Up @@ -20,10 +20,10 @@
#include <fstream>
#include <iostream>

#include <qapplication.h>
#include <qstring.h>
#include <qstringlist.h>
#include <qclipboard.h>
#include <QApplication>
#include <QString>
#include <QStringList>
#include <QClipboard>

#include "qgsclipboard.h"

Expand Down
5 changes: 4 additions & 1 deletion src/gui/qgscontinuouscolorrenderer.cpp
Expand Up @@ -23,7 +23,10 @@
#include "qgssymbologyutils.h"
#include "qgsmarkercatalogue.h"
#include "qgssymbol.h"
#include <qdom.h>

#include <QDomElement>
#include <QPainter>
#include <QPixmap>

QgsContinuousColorRenderer::QgsContinuousColorRenderer(QGis::VectorType type): mMinimumSymbol(0), mMaximumSymbol(0)
{
Expand Down
5 changes: 2 additions & 3 deletions src/gui/qgscontinuouscolorrenderer.h
Expand Up @@ -19,14 +19,13 @@
#define QGSCONTINUOUSCOLORRENDERER_H

#include "qgsrenderer.h"
#include <qpainter.h>
#include "qgsmaptopixel.h"
#include "qgspoint.h"
#include "qgsfeature.h"
#include <QPixmap>
#include <iostream>

class QgsSymbol;
class QPainter;
class QPixmap;

/**Renderer class which interpolates rgb values linear between the minimum and maximum value of the classification field*/
class QgsContinuousColorRenderer: public QgsRenderer
Expand Down
3 changes: 2 additions & 1 deletion src/gui/qgscoordinatetransform.cpp
Expand Up @@ -19,7 +19,8 @@
#include "qgscoordinatetransform.h"

//qt includes
#include <qdom.h>
#include <QDomNode>
#include <QDomElement>

// Qt4-only includes to go here
#include <QTextOStream>
Expand Down
2 changes: 1 addition & 1 deletion src/gui/qgscoordinatetransform.h
Expand Up @@ -19,7 +19,7 @@
#define QGSCOORDINATETRANSFORM_H

//qt includes
#include <qobject.h>
#include <QObject>

//qgis includes
#include "qgspoint.h"
Expand Down
2 changes: 1 addition & 1 deletion src/gui/qgsdelattrdialog.cpp
Expand Up @@ -17,7 +17,7 @@

#include "qgsdelattrdialog.h"
#include "qgsfield.h"
#include <q3header.h>
#include <Q3Header>

QgsDelAttrDialog::QgsDelAttrDialog(Q3Header* header): QgsDelAttrDialogBase()
{
Expand Down
6 changes: 3 additions & 3 deletions src/gui/qgsgraduatedsymbolrenderer.cpp
Expand Up @@ -22,9 +22,9 @@
#include "qgslegendsymbologyitem.h"
#include "qgssymbologyutils.h"
#include "qgssvgcache.h"
#include <qdom.h>
#include <qpixmap.h>
#include <q3picture.h>
#include <QDomNode>
#include <QDomElement>
#include <QPixmap>


QgsGraduatedSymbolRenderer::QgsGraduatedSymbolRenderer(QGis::VectorType type)
Expand Down
12 changes: 6 additions & 6 deletions src/gui/qgslabel.cpp
Expand Up @@ -17,13 +17,13 @@
#include <fstream>
#include <math.h> //needed for win32 build (ts)

#include <qstring.h>
#include <qfont.h>
#include <qfontmetrics.h>
#include <QString>
#include <QFont>
#include <QFontMetrics>

#include <qpainter.h>
#include <qmatrix.h>
#include <qdom.h>
#include <QPainter>
#include <QDomNode>
#include <QDomElement>

#include "qgis.h"
#include "qgsfeature.h"
Expand Down
2 changes: 1 addition & 1 deletion src/gui/qgsmaplayerinterface.h
Expand Up @@ -18,7 +18,7 @@
/**
* Interface class for map layer plugins
*/
#include <qobject.h>
#include <QObject>
#include "qgisapp.h"
class Q3MainWindow;

Expand Down
2 changes: 1 addition & 1 deletion src/gui/qgsmarkerdialog.cpp
Expand Up @@ -22,7 +22,7 @@

#include <QDir>
#include <QFileDialog>
#include <q3iconview.h>
#include <Q3IconView>
#include <QPixmap>

#include "qgsconfig.h"
Expand Down
8 changes: 4 additions & 4 deletions src/gui/qgsnewconnection.cpp
Expand Up @@ -16,10 +16,10 @@
***************************************************************************/
/* $Id$ */
#include <iostream>
#include <qsettings.h>
#include <qlineedit.h>
#include <qcheckbox.h>
#include <qmessagebox.h>

#include <QSettings>
#include <QMessageBox>

#include "qgsnewconnection.h"
#include "qgscontexthelp.h"
extern "C"
Expand Down
1 change: 1 addition & 0 deletions src/gui/qgsoptions.cpp
Expand Up @@ -22,6 +22,7 @@
#include "qgisapp.h"
#include "qgslayerprojectionselector.h"
#include "qgssvgcache.h"
#include "qgsspatialrefsys.h"
#include <QFileDialog>
#include <QSettings>
#include <QColorDialog>
Expand Down

0 comments on commit 491ea95

Please sign in to comment.